Win a €3,000 first prize in the competition from Munster Literature Centre
The annual international Séan O'Faoláin International Short Story Competition is given for original, unpublished and unbroadcast short stories up to 3,000 words. Stories may be on any subject, and written in any style.
The first prize is €3,000, a one-week residency at Anam Cara Retreat, a featured reading at the Cork International Short Story Conference and publication in Southword. The second prize is €500 and publication in Southword, and four runners up will each receive £250 and publication in Southword.
The entry fee is €19 per story.
The closing date is 31 July.
